                    There's an interview on You Tube where Burnett said she'd host SNL if asked; but I think she was either just being nice or trying to avoid controversy.
                    It's pretty well known Lorne Michaels is not a fan of Carol Burnett's brand of sketch comedy. When SNL was in its early years he'd use the phrase "too Burnett" to describe skits that he thought were too hack-ish.
